Macau SAR Government has recently announced that the city’s annual cash handout for local residents this year will start on 15 July but with a significant change in the eligibility to receive the benefit.
For the first time since the cash handout, officially called “Wealth Partaking Scheme”, was launched in 2008, will only be received by Macau permanent and non-permanent residents who have stayed in Macau for at least 183 days last year.
All Macau residents can check their eligibility via the Macau One Account, with eligible permanent and non-permanent residents to continue receiving MOP 10,000 and MOP 6,000, respectively, this year.
A total of 717,018 permanent residents and 30,850 non-permanent residents received the cash handout last year – regardless how many days they spent in Macau in the past year. – GNM
